Road Resurfacing in Little Rock, AR
Road resurfacing services involve restoring the surface of existing driveways, parking lots, or private roads to improve their appearance and functionality. This process typically includes removing the top layer of worn or damaged asphalt and applying a new layer to create a smooth, durable surface. Projects can range from small residential driveways to larger commercial parking areas, helping property owners enhance curb appeal and ensure safe, reliable access. Homeowners considering resurfacing often want to understand the scope of work, the materials used, and how the process can extend the lifespan of their existing pavement.
Before requesting road resurfacing, property owners should consider the current condition of their pavement, including cracks, potholes, or uneven areas. It's also helpful to evaluate whether the existing base is stable and suitable for resurfacing or if repairs are needed beforehand. Understanding the project's scope, including any necessary repairs or preparatory work, can help ensure the final result meets expectations. Proper planning and clear communication about the desired outcome can contribute to a longer-lasting, visually appealing surface.

Common Road Resurfacing Jobs
Asphalt Resurfacing - restores the smoothness and appearance of existing asphalt driveways and parking lots.
Pothole Repair - fills and levels damaged areas to prevent further deterioration and improve safety.
Crack Sealing - seals surface cracks to prevent water infiltration and extend pavement life.
Overlay Projects - applies a new layer of asphalt over worn surfaces for a fresh, durable finish.
Parking Lot Resurfacing - revitalizes commercial parking areas to enhance curb appeal and functionality.
Road Rehabilitation - involves extensive work to restore heavily damaged roads for safe use.
Road Resurfacing Questions
What is road resurfacing? Road resurfacing involves applying a new layer of asphalt or other materials to restore a worn or damaged driveway or parking lot surface.
When should a property owner consider resurfacing? Resurfacing is recommended when existing pavement shows signs of cracking, potholes, or significant wear that affects safety and appearance.
What types of projects are suitable for resurfacing? Resurfacing works well for driveways, parking lots, and private roads that need repair without complete reconstruction.
How does resurfacing improve a property's curb appeal? It provides a smooth, clean surface that enhances the overall look and value of the property.
